Cuil - New Search Engine by Ex-Googlers

Published by Karl Ufert under Announcements, Search Marketing, Web 2.0, Web News

Cuil Homepage

Former Google employees just launched a new Search Engine–Cuil (www.cuil.com). According to a Reuters article today, Cuil, which is being launched to compete with the Search giant, “goes beyond prevailing search techniques that focus on Web links and audience traffic patterns and instead analyzes the context of each page and the concepts behind each user search request.”

There is new layout and “psychology” to Cuil. It enables searchers to reference cross-topics in a more graphically engaging, social networking-intelligent manner.

MyLifeInSmiles.com Launched!

Published by Karl Ufert under Uncategorized, Web 2.0

Gen Art - Crest Whitestrips MyLifeInSmiles.com Photo Contest Website

Mitra Creative is excited to announce the April 4 launch of MYLIFEINSMILES.COM. Developed for the New York-based GEN ART, “the leading arts and entertainment organization dedicated to showcasing emerging fashion designers, filmmakers, musicians and visual artists”, MyLifeInSmiles.com is a Web 2.0 photo contest site especially designed for Gen Art’s sponsor, the Crest Whitestrips® family of products.

MyLifeInSmiles.com is a full-featured, metadata-rich Web 2.0 file sharing site which enables visitors — contest participants – to upload photos of their favorite smiles. A limited number of photos will be selected as winners of the contest and featured in a special photo exhibition to be hosted by Gen Art in late spring.
